Sarah Cahill’s project to commission 18 composers protesting and reflecting on war, violence, and the nature of peace, is a fantastic project that has been made even more lovely by the addition of breathtaking three channel video projections by John Sanborn.
Two excerpts from the Cal Performances in Berkeley, CA on January 25th, 2009:

Reactable. Really object-oriented synthesis.
“The instrument is based on a translucent and luminous round table, and by putting these pucks on the Reactable surface, by turning them and connecting them to each other, performers can combine different elements like synthesizers, effects, sample loops or control elements in order to create a unique and flexible composition.” [...]
